Keyword Organ Trafficking

Ship of Theseus

2012 Movies

Taken Heart

2017 Movies

Bargain

2015 Movies

Night Mail

2014 Movies

Filthy Luck

2014 Movies

The Price We Pay

2023 Movies

Lowlife

2017 Movies

B.O.R.N.

1989 Movies

The Orangutan King

2005 Movies

The Market

2011 Movies

Defilers

1991 Movies

Harvested Alive

2016 Movies